The United States Marine Lighting Market is a dynamic industry driven by the growing demand for energy-efficient and durable lighting solutions in the marine sector. With a focus on safety, visibility, and aesthetics, the market offers a wide range of products such as LED navigation lights, underwater lights, deck lights, and interior cabin lights. Key trends in the market include the adoption of advanced LED technology for its long lifespan and low power consumption, as well as the incorporation of smart lighting systems for enhanced control and customization. The market is highly competitive, with key players including manufacturers, distributors, and retailers catering to the diverse needs of boat owners, marine enthusiasts, and commercial marine operators. Continued innovation, product development, and regulatory compliance are essential for sustained growth in this market.
In the US Marine Lighting Market, there is a growing trend towards LED lighting due to its energy efficiency, durability, and long lifespan, making it a popular choice for marine vessels. LED technology is increasingly being incorporated into navigation lights, underwater lighting, deck lighting, and interior cabin lighting. Another notable trend is the focus on sustainable and eco-friendly lighting solutions, with more manufacturers offering products that are compliant with marine environmental regulations. Additionally, there is a demand for smart lighting systems that can be controlled remotely, providing convenience and customization options for boat owners. Overall, the US Marine Lighting Market is moving towards innovative, energy-efficient, and environmentally conscious lighting solutions to meet the evolving needs of the industry.
In the US Marine Lighting Market, challenges include increasing competition from overseas manufacturers offering lower-priced products, fluctuating raw material costs impacting pricing strategies, and the need for continual innovation to meet changing consumer preferences and environmental regulations. Additionally, the market is influenced by factors such as economic conditions, consumer spending on non-essential items like marine lighting, and the impact of seasonal variations on demand. Companies in this market must also navigate supply chain disruptions and logistical challenges, especially for products sourced internationally. Overall, staying competitive in the US Marine Lighting Market requires a balance of cost-effective manufacturing, product differentiation through technology and design, and a keen understanding of market trends and regulations.

Government policies related to the US Marine Lighting Market primarily focus on promoting energy efficiency and sustainability. The US Coast Guard and the National Marine Fisheries Service have regulations in place to ensure that marine lighting does not disrupt the natural habitat of marine life, particularly endangered species like sea turtles. Additionally, the Department of Energy provides guidelines and incentives for energy-efficient lighting solutions in maritime applications to reduce energy consumption and greenhouse gas emissions. The US Environmental Protection Agency also regulates the disposal of marine lighting waste to minimize environmental impact. Overall, government policies in the US Marine Lighting Market aim to balance the need for effective lighting solutions with environmental conservation efforts.
